Quality of Service (QoS)
QoS prioritizes bandwidth for specific devices or applications. For example, you can prioritize video streaming or online gaming to ensure smooth performance even when multiple devices are connected. This feature is crucial for maintaining quality in high-demand scenarios.
Beamforming Technology
Beamforming directs WiFi signals toward connected devices rather than broadcasting signals equally in all directions. This targeted approach improves signal strength, increases speed, and reduces latency, especially for devices farther from the booster.
MU-MIMO (Multi-User, Multiple Input, Multiple Output)
MU-MIMO allows a WiFi booster to communicate with multiple devices simultaneously. This reduces waiting times and increases overall network efficiency, making it ideal for busy households or offices.
Smart Band Steering
Smart band steering automatically directs devices to the optimal frequency band (2.4 GHz or 5 GHz). This ensures devices are connected to the best available band, improving speed and reducing congestion.

Mesh Networking Compatibility
Many WiFi boosters now support mesh networks, allowing multiple units to work together for expanded coverage. This setup eliminates dead zones and provides a unified network experience throughout large spaces.
AI-Driven Network Management
Artificial intelligence helps optimize network performance by automatically adjusting settings based on usage patterns. It can also detect and mitigate interference or security threats in real-time.
Enhanced Security Features
Security remains a priority, with features like WPA3 encryption, automatic firmware updates, and integrated firewalls to protect your network from threats.
